LK51 JVG is a 2001 Chrysler Grand Voyager in Blue with a 2,499c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 56.5%.
Across all 2001 Chrysler Grand Voyager models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.4% with a typical mileage of 93,953 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Chrysler Grand Voyager f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 26,896 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LK51 JVG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Chrysler Grand Voyager typ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 25 years old, this Chrysler Grand Voyager is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
